February 23, 2022S.11 E.16 – Steve Shalaty of ImmolationSend us Fan MailWe welcome one of the more prolific drummers in modern death metal, Steve Shalaty of Immolation, onto IUF. The new album, “Acts Of God”, may just be the band's best work to date. Steve sits with us to talk about the album's production process from day one, which got to a point where he would be working on a single track for 6 months. Steve also talks about being a fan of Immolation before he joined them in 2003, listening to tape decks from the bands previous records from the early to mid 90s. He has a lot to be grateful for while drumming for a death metal favorite that seems to be aging like fine wine. “Acts Of God” not only showcases each of Steve's bandmates' talents, but also his own. From themes, to the songwriting, and the album art - “Acts Of God” is quite the release to kick off 2022 with, as it will please many death metal fanatics out there. February 23, 2022S.11 E.15 - Guillaume Rieth of CelesteSend us Fan MailThere's a storm brewing out in the eastern regions of Lyon, France. Enter the black metal avant-garde outfit named Celeste, who are finally getting the worldwide recognition they have deserved for the last decade or so. Guitarist Guillaume Rieth of Celeste is our guest today as he describes that “storm” being a culmination of playing over 500 shows around the world while releasing 5 albums since 2005. The new and 6th album, titled “Assassine(s)”, is also the band's first with Nuclear Blast Records. Guillaume talks about the new found relationship with NB and the excitement of starting this new chapter in the band's music career. One interesting fact about Celeste lies within the compositions of their songs, which are all sung in their native language of French. It's an element of their songwriting that makes them stand out from the rest, and Guillaume mentions how it gives the songs that much more depth and meaning on the delivery. France continues to deliver more and more talent in the world of heavy metal, and Celeste is one you will not want to overlook.
